
For welders and fabricators, clear and precise layout lines are the foundation of a good build. The Markal Valve Action Paint Marker in White is the industry standard for making highly visible marks on steel, aluminum, and stainless steel. When working in low-light shop environments or on dark metal surfaces, the bright white liquid paint stands out significantly better than soapstone or standard ink, ensuring your cut lines and weld points are unmistakable. The paint is formulated to dry rapidly, meaning you can stack materials or move on to the next step of fabrication without worrying about wiping away your measurements.
One of the most critical aspects for welders working with high-grade materials is contamination. This marker is specifically safe for use on stainless steel and exotic alloys because it is formulated to not cause pitting or corrosion. This gives you peace of mind when marking up expensive pipe or plate that requires strict purity standards. The marker's tip is built tough; the medium bullet tip allows for bold, readable lines but is hard enough to write over mill scale, rust, and oil without clogging or fraying immediately. If the tip does get dry or dirty, the valve action system allows you to pump fresh paint through, clearing the nib and getting you back to work instantly.
Whether you are marking cut lengths, identifying material grades, or numbering parts for assembly, this paint marker offers the permanence you need. The marks hold up against heat, handling, and weather, ensuring that your identification stays on the metal from the fabrication shop to the job site. It is an essential tool for every welder's pocket, providing the durability of paint with the precision of a pen.
